How to Cut Porcelain Tile Without Chipping?

Porcelain tile is strong, durable, and beautiful. Yet many installers struggle with chipped edges that ruin the final appearance and increase material waste.

To cut porcelain tile without chipping, use the correct cutting tool, choose a high-quality diamond blade, support the tile properly, make slow and controlled cuts, and score accurately before applying pressure. These steps help create cleaner edges and reduce breakage.

Porcelain is much denser than standard ceramic tile. This density makes it highly durable, but it also means mistakes during cutting become more visible. Understanding the right tools and techniques can significantly improve cut quality and reduce project costs.

Which Tools Minimize Tile Edge Damage?

Many chipped edges can be traced back to using the wrong cutting equipment. Even high-quality porcelain tiles may fail to cut cleanly when paired with unsuitable tools.

Wet saws, professional manual tile cutters, rail cutters, and premium diamond cutting systems are among the best tools for minimizing edge damage when cutting porcelain tile.

The tool should match the tile thickness, size, and complexity of the cut.

Why Tool Selection Matters

Porcelain tile has a dense structure.

Unlike softer ceramic products, porcelain resists cutting forces more aggressively. Poor tools create excessive vibration, uneven pressure, and uncontrolled fractures.

These problems often appear as:

  • Edge chipping
  • Surface flaking
  • Corner breakage
  • Uneven cuts

Choosing the right equipment reduces these risks significantly.

Common Porcelain Tile Cutting Tools

Tool Best Application Chipping Risk
Wet Saw Straight precision cuts Very Low
Manual Tile Cutter Repetitive straight cuts Low
Rail Cutter Large-format tiles Low
Angle Grinder Curves and notches Moderate
Tile Nippers Small adjustments Moderate
Basic Snap Cutter Thin tiles only Higher

Professional installers often rely heavily on wet saws because they provide excellent control.

Wet Saws

Wet saws remain one of the most reliable options.

Water performs several functions:

  • Cools the blade
  • Reduces friction
  • Minimizes dust
  • Improves cut quality

Because the blade remains cooler, it cuts more smoothly through dense porcelain.

Professional Manual Tile Cutters

Modern porcelain cutters have improved considerably.

High-quality models provide:

  • Strong breaking mechanisms
  • Consistent scoring pressure
  • Better alignment systems

These features help create cleaner breaks after scoring.

Rail Cutting Systems

Large-format porcelain tiles require extra support.

Rail systems help maintain:

  • Straight cutting paths
  • Stable tile positioning
  • Consistent scoring pressure

These advantages become especially important when working with large slabs.

Tool Quality Makes a Difference

Not all cutting tools perform equally.

A premium tool often provides:

Feature Benefit
Strong Frame Less vibration
Better Bearings Smoother movement
Accurate Guides Cleaner cuts
Durable Components Consistent results

The cost of a better tool is often lower than the cost of wasted tile.

Supporting the Tile Properly

Even the best cutter cannot compensate for poor support.

The tile should remain:

  • Flat
  • Stable
  • Fully supported
  • Free from movement

Proper support helps the tool perform as intended and reduces edge damage.

Should Tiles Be Wet Before Cutting?

Many beginners wonder whether soaking porcelain tiles before cutting improves results. The answer depends on the cutting method being used.

Porcelain tiles generally do not need to be soaked before cutting. However, wet-cutting systems that continuously cool the blade with water often produce cleaner cuts and significantly reduce chipping.

This distinction is important.

Wet cutting and soaking are not the same thing.

Understanding Porcelain Density

Porcelain has a very low water absorption rate.

Because of this characteristic, soaking usually provides little benefit.

Unlike some traditional materials, porcelain does not absorb enough water to meaningfully change its cutting behavior.

Why Wet Saws Work Well

The success of wet saws comes from blade cooling rather than tile saturation.

Water helps by:

  • Lowering blade temperature
  • Reducing friction
  • Preventing overheating
  • Flushing away debris

These factors improve overall cutting quality.

Dry Cutting Versus Wet Cutting

Factor Dry Cutting Wet Cutting
Dust Production High Low
Blade Temperature Higher Lower
Chipping Risk Higher Lower
Cut Quality Good Excellent
Blade Life Shorter Longer

For professional results, wet cutting usually offers advantages.

Situations Where Wet Cutting Is Recommended

Wet cutting is particularly useful for:

  • Large-format tiles
  • Thick porcelain
  • Visible edge cuts
  • Premium finishes
  • High-volume projects

In these situations, cleaner cuts often justify the additional setup.

Potential Problems With Dry Cutting

Dry cutting can still produce acceptable results.

However, excessive heat may cause:

  • Blade wear
  • Rough edges
  • Increased vibration
  • More chipping

These issues become more noticeable on dense porcelain products.

When Dry Cutting Is Appropriate

Dry cutting may still work well for:

  • Small projects
  • Quick adjustments
  • Outdoor installations
  • Minor notches

The key is maintaining proper technique and using the correct blade.

Cooling Matters More Than Soaking

Many installers focus on tile moisture.

In reality, blade temperature usually has a greater effect on cut quality.

A properly cooled blade often produces smoother results than a dry blade cutting a soaked tile.

Additional Dust Control Benefits

Wet cutting also improves job-site cleanliness.

Benefits include:

  • Better visibility
  • Reduced airborne particles
  • Easier cleanup
  • Improved worker comfort

These advantages contribute to a safer and more efficient work environment.

How Does Blade Choice Affect Results?

Many cutting problems are blamed on the tile itself when the real issue is the blade. Blade selection has a direct impact on edge quality.

Blade choice affects cutting speed, edge smoothness, heat generation, vibration levels, and the likelihood of chipping. A high-quality porcelain-rated diamond blade typically produces the best results.

The blade acts as the primary cutting interface between the machine and the tile.

Why Blade Quality Matters

Porcelain is extremely hard.

A blade designed for softer materials may struggle to cut efficiently.

Poor cutting performance often leads to:

  • Rough edges
  • Increased pressure
  • Excessive vibration
  • Surface damage

These issues increase the likelihood of visible chips.

Types of Diamond Blades

Several blade styles exist.

Each offers different performance characteristics.

Blade Type Cutting Quality Speed
Continuous Rim Excellent Moderate
Turbo Rim Very Good Fast
Segmented Rim Fair Very Fast
Premium Porcelain Blade Excellent Moderate

Continuous-rim blades are often preferred for porcelain because they create smoother cuts.

Continuous-Rim Blades

These blades have uninterrupted cutting edges.

Advantages include:

  • Cleaner finishes
  • Reduced vibration
  • Lower chipping rates
  • Better edge appearance

Many professional tile installers consider them the standard choice for visible cuts.

Blade Wear and Performance

Even premium blades wear over time.

Signs of wear include:

  • Slower cutting
  • Increased heat
  • Rougher edges
  • More chipping

Replacing worn blades often restores cutting performance immediately.

Matching the Blade to the Tile

Not all porcelain tiles are identical.

Some products feature:

  • Polished finishes
  • Textured surfaces
  • Extra thickness
  • Large formats

Certain blades perform better on specific tile types.

Manufacturers often provide blade recommendations for optimal results.

Blade Speed and Feed Rate

The operator also influences blade performance.

Forcing the tile too quickly can create:

  • Excessive pressure
  • Deflection
  • Edge fractures

Allowing the blade to cut at its intended speed generally improves results.

Investing in Better Blades

A higher-quality blade may cost more initially.

However, benefits often include:

Benefit Impact
Cleaner Edges Better appearance
Less Waste Lower material costs
Faster Cutting Improved efficiency
Longer Life Better value

Many installers find that premium blades reduce overall project expenses by minimizing damaged tiles.

Can Scoring Reduce Chipping Risks?

Scoring is one of the most overlooked techniques in porcelain tile cutting. Yet it can greatly influence the final quality of the cut.

Accurate scoring creates a controlled fracture line that guides the break, helping reduce chipping, improve cut accuracy, and lower the risk of uncontrolled tile damage.

A clean score line acts as a roadmap for the break.

Without it, stress may spread unpredictably through the tile.

What Is Scoring?

Scoring involves creating a shallow line on the tile surface using a hardened cutting wheel.

This line weakens the tile in a controlled way.

When pressure is applied later, the tile tends to separate along the score.

Why Scoring Helps

Porcelain contains internal stresses.

A score line concentrates those stresses in a specific location.

This creates a more predictable break.

The result is often:

  • Cleaner edges
  • Straighter cuts
  • Less waste
  • Fewer chips

Proper Scoring Technique

Successful scoring depends on consistency.

Key Steps

  1. Align the tile carefully.
  2. Make one continuous pass.
  3. Maintain steady pressure.
  4. Avoid stopping midway.
  5. Snap promptly after scoring.

Consistency is more important than force.

Common Scoring Mistakes

Several errors increase chipping risks.

Mistake Result
Multiple Passes Rough edges
Uneven Pressure Inconsistent breaks
Weak Score Line Poor snapping
Excessive Pressure Surface damage

Professional installers typically aim for one smooth scoring pass.

Scoring Large-Format Porcelain

Large-format tiles present additional challenges.

Their size increases the chance of:

  • Flexing
  • Uneven pressure
  • Off-line breaks

Long rail cutters help maintain consistent scoring across the entire tile length.

Combining Scoring With Proper Support

Scoring alone is not enough.

The tile must also remain:

  • Fully supported
  • Properly aligned
  • Free from vibration

Support and scoring work together to reduce chipping.

Why Practice Improves Results

Scoring is a skill that improves with experience.

Practice helps installers learn:

  • Proper pressure
  • Cutter behavior
  • Tile characteristics
  • Breaking force

A few test cuts can reveal valuable information before working on expensive material.

The Role of Patience

Many chipped tiles result from rushing.

Taking extra time to:

  • Align accurately
  • Score carefully
  • Apply controlled pressure

often leads to noticeably cleaner cuts.

For porcelain tile, patience frequently produces better results than speed.

Conclusion

Cutting porcelain tile without chipping depends on using the right tools, selecting a quality diamond blade, maintaining proper support, and applying careful scoring techniques. Wet cutting systems, controlled pressure, and attention to detail help create cleaner edges, reduce waste, and deliver a more professional finished installation.
